Does Less Sun Mean More OCD?

  • July 13, 2018
  • Reuben Friedlander
  • Neurodiversity, Obsessive Compulsive Disorder (OCD), ocd
A new compilation of data assembled at Binghamton University NY suggests the prevalence of OCD, or obsessive compulsive disorder, is lower in areas that get more sunlight.

Is “Fear Reversal Learning” Impaired In People With OCD?
News

Is “Fear Reversal Learning” Impaired in People with OCD?

  • March 20, 2017
  • Megan Baksh
  • Neurodiversity, Obsessive Compulsive Disorder (OCD), ocd
Researchers tested OCD patients in an effort to examine how successful patients were at reversing their thought patterns when a once threatening stimulus became safe, and conversely, when a safe stimulus became threatening.
